The sealed metric four point contact ball bearing is the kind that to install the sealing rings on both sides of an open ball bearing with the same structure.
The bearing can carry loads from axial and radial directions as well as the single load from the axial direction.
The sealed metric type X ball bearing adopts a four-point contact ball structure and integrates high-performance sealing rings on both sides of the open bearing design. This sealing configuration helps prevent dust, moisture, and external contaminants from entering the raceway area while also reducing lubricant leakage during long-term operation. As a result, the bearing maintains stable running accuracy and reliable performance even under demanding industrial working conditions.
The internal four-point contact design enables the steel balls to maintain stable contact with the raceway at four separate points. This structure allows the bearing to simultaneously support radial loads, axial loads, and combined loads from multiple directions. Compared with conventional deep groove ball bearings, the sealed metric type X ball bearing provides higher load carrying efficiency while maintaining a compact and lightweight structure. Many equipment manufacturers choose this bearing type when installation space is limited but higher operational stability and rotational accuracy are required.
The bearing is designed with low friction characteristics, which helps reduce torque during operation and improves rotational efficiency at high speeds. This feature allows the bearing to operate smoothly in applications that require continuous rotation, precise positioning, or reduced energy consumption. The optimized internal geometry also minimizes heat generation during high-speed running, helping extend service life and reduce maintenance frequency.
The double-side sealing structure significantly improves bearing protection in environments where dust particles, metal debris, cooling liquids, or humidity may affect operating reliability. The sealing rings effectively preserve internal lubrication while reducing contamination risks, making the bearing suitable for long-term use in automated production systems and precision industrial machinery. Users can reduce maintenance downtime and improve overall equipment operating stability by selecting sealed four-point contact ball bearings for demanding applications.
The sealed metric type X ball bearing is widely used in equipment that requires compact structure design combined with high axial load capacity. Typical applications include robotic systems, rotary tables, medical devices, packaging equipment, semiconductor machinery, textile equipment, lightweight slewing systems, and precision automation assemblies. Many engineers also use this bearing in machine components that primarily carry axial loads while still requiring moderate radial load support.
Because the bearing can support loads from both axial directions, it provides greater installation flexibility in complex mechanical systems. The four-point contact structure reduces the need for additional bearing arrangements in certain applications, which helps simplify equipment design and lower assembly costs. At the same time, the compact cross-sectional profile allows designers to reduce the overall size and weight of machinery without sacrificing operational performance.
